NATS Sink
Provided by: "Apache Software Foundation"
Support Level for this Kamelet is: "Stable"
Send data to NATS topics.
Configuration Options
The following table summarizes the configuration options available for the nats-sink
Kamelet:
Property | Name | Description | Type | Default | Example |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Servers | Required Comma separated list of NATS Servers. | string | |||
Topic | Required NATS Topic name. | string | |||
Jetstream Async Enabled | Sets whether to operate JetStream requests asynchronously. | boolean | true | ||
Jetstream Enabled | Sets whether to enable JetStream support for this endpoint. | boolean | false | ||
Jetstream Stream Name | Sets the name of the JetStream stream to use. | string |
Dependencies
At runtime, the nats-sink
Kamelet relies upon the presence of the following dependencies:
-
camel:nats
-
camel:kamelet
Camel JBang usage
Prerequisites
-
You’ve installed JBang.
-
You have executed the following command:
jbang app install camel@apache/camel
Supposing you have a file named route.yaml with this content:
- route:
from:
uri: "kamelet:timer-source"
parameters:
period: 10000
message: 'test'
steps:
- to:
uri: "kamelet:nats-sink"
You can now run it directly through the following command
camel run route.yaml
NATS Sink Kamelet Description
NATS Messaging System
This Kamelet integrates with NATS, a high-performance messaging system designed for cloud-native applications, IoT messaging, and microservices architectures.
High Performance
NATS provides extremely high throughput and low latency messaging, making it suitable for real-time applications and high-frequency trading systems.
Subject-Based Messaging
Uses NATS subject-based messaging where messages are published to subjects (similar to topics) for efficient message routing and delivery.
